Women's Basketball Travels to Chicago on Tuesday Night

TERRE HAUTE, Ind.-- The Rose-Hulman Institute of Technology women's basketball team travels to the University of Chicago for a Tuesday night non-conference matchup.  The Maroons are ranked No. 23 in the latest D3hoops.com weekly top 25 poll released on Monday night.

Rose-Hulman Notes & News:

* Rose-Hulman has been picked to finish third in the HCAC according to this year's league coaches poll.
* Berea, which defeated the Engineers in the season opener, improved to 5-1 with the victory after compiling a 22-4 record last year.
* The Engineers finished the 2018-19 season advancing to the HCAC Championship Game against Transylvania University.  
* Rose-Hulman finished the 2018-19 year with an overall record of 20-7, and went 16-2 in HCAC play.
* The Fightin' Engineers will look to welcome in a large freshman class this year after graduating their top six scorers.    
* Returnees for the Engineers include senior Hannah Woody, junior Morgan Brown, and sophomore Caitlin Young.
* Rose-Hulman returns to action in the Midwest Challenge this weekend, facing Illinois Wesleyan then either DePauw or host Washington Univ. (Mo.).

#23 Chicago Maroons (4-2, 0-0 UAA) News & Notes:

* Chicago stands 4-2 on the season after a win over Kenyon in its most recent outing.
* The Maroons are ranked No. 23 in this week's D3hoops.com national top 25 poll.
* The Maroons featuring five players averaging double figures in scoring, led by Mia Farrell at 15.2 points per game.
